Residential Properties Ltd. is on the move once again, announcing its latest expansion through the acquisition of Island Reality, a well-established firm based in Jamestown. This strategic move reflects RPL's commitment to growth and enhancing its service offerings in the real estate market.
With over $1 billion in sales reported for 2024, RPL has solidified its position as a leading player in the industry. The addition of Island Reality, known for its deep roots in the local community and extensive experience, is expected to bolster RPL's portfolio and strengthen its market presence.
